Cover of Driftwood Bay

Driftwood Bay

If you loved Chasing the Clouds Away's quilting-circle confessions and second-chance grace, Driftwood Bay wraps you in the same coastal quiet where every neighbor knows your prayer requests. Denise Hunter gives you a heroine hollowed by loss yet anchored by faith, a steady hero whose love unfolds like Sunday morning, and those tear-jerking family reconciliations that prove forgiveness still heals everything.

Cover of The Simple Wild

The Simple Wild

If the raw emotional depth of Archer's Voice left you aching for more brooding heroes whose guarded hearts unravel through patient love, 'The Simple Wild' by K.A. Tucker delivers that same gut-punch with a gruff pilot and city girl clashing in Alaskan wilds. Echoing Archer's trauma redemption and sensual barriers, it weaves family reconciliation and personal growth into a tear-jerking romance that's authentically cathartic. Cover of Things We Never Got Over

Things We Never Got Over

If Kenna's brutal fight for redemption against a town that refused to forget gutted you, Naomi's reckoning with her own family wreckage in Knockemout will finish the job. Lucy Score engineers the same visceral heartbreak—flawed heroine, brooding alpha drowning in duty, slow-burn heat that detonates without diminishing the ache—but cranks the banter dial until you're laughing through the tears.
